Composed by J. H. Carr. Arranged by Frederic Bacon-Shone. Christian,Gospel,Sacred. Octavo. 10 pages. Heather Bacon-Shone #2215639. Published by Heather Bacon-Shone (A0.886416).

A new version of this gospel hymn takes it into more traditional harmonic territory, with this arrangement for SATB choir and organ (or piano) accompaniment. The accompaniment part is simple; the vocals move through a variety of voicings and harmonies at the early intermediate level. Accessible for most church choirs. Liturgical use: judgment (day), repentance or confession, moral and ethical choices/righteousness.
